There are 3 bowls and 5 nuts. All these nuts are to be distributed into three bowls where any bowl can contain any number of nuts. In how many ways these nuts can be distributed into these bowls if all the bowls and all the nuts are different? Correct Answer 3<sup>5</sup>

All the nuts and all the bowls are different.

∴ Required number of ways of distribution = 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 = 35
